Precision
Flat Pack Networks
8900 Series
Precision absolute and ratio tolerances available
Qualified to MIL-R-83401 /03, /10 and /15
Qualified to characteristics M, K and H
Custom schematics readily available
Absolute TCR to ±15ppm/°C
TaNFilm
®
resistor networks are designed for use in applications requiring a high degree of reliability, stability, tight
tolerance and TCR tracking, and low noise. The sputtering process for resistor formation has been perfected to allow a
continuous feed production line under high vacuum conditions, thus, insuring uniformity of properties between networks.
Laser trimming makes tight ratios easily achievable. The gold plated copper leads are solid phase welded to a large
area of gold conductor pads on the ceramic substrate assuring the most reliable termination and long term stability.
The Tantalum Nitride resistor material is passivated for environmental protection insuring excellent performance far
superior to military requirements.
Our TaNFilm
®
process enables us to manufacture networks containing different resistance values and still maintain tight
tolerances and tracking characteristics. The nature of our photo-etch process makes it readily adaptable to meet each
individual customer’s needs. Custom circuit designs and special mechanical configurations can be easily achieved
with a modest set up charge while maintaining our high standards of precision and reliability.
